Virginia Lee Burtons Name May Bring To Mind A Steam Shovel And A Man Called Mike Mulligan, A Charming Little House, And A Snowplow Named Katy. Yet To Speak Only Of Burtons Achievements As A Picture Book Creator Would Be To Paint Only Part Of The Canvas Of Her Life. She Was Also A Dancer, An Illustrator For An Early Boston Newspaper, And A Musician, Designer, Sculptor, And Printmaker. Together With Her Husband George Demetrios, Virginia Enjoyed A Full Life. They Raised Two Sons, Gardened And Kept Sheep, Entertained Friends, And Taught Art And Design Classes. Led By Burton, The Design Classes Made Up Of Local Artists Evolved Into The Folly Cove Designers. A Cooperative Of Sorts, This Group Created Elaborately Intricate Designs Of Rural Scenes And Other Natural Elements, Which They Would Carve Into Linoleum And Print Onto Fabrics.Simultaneously, Burton Began Her Career In Childrens Book Writing And Illustration. The Early Success Of Her First Books, Choo Choo, Mike Mulligan And His Steam Shovel, And The Little House, As Well As Other Books Was An Auspicious Beginning For Burton, And The Books Have Become Classic And Lasting Examples Of The Fine Art Of Childrens Book Creation.Wellknown Childrens Literature Expert Barbara Elleman Introduces The Exuberant Life, Art, And Books Of Virginia Lee Burton, Complemented By Family Photographs, Illustrations, And Other Images Of Her Inspiring Work.
